module orao_hw
(
input [15:0] addr, // CPU Interface
input [7:0] data_in,
output reg [7:0] data_out,
input we,
output pix,
output HSync,
output VSync,
output de,
input [10:0] ps2_key,
output audio, // CB2 audio
input ioctl_download,
input [7:0] ioctl_index,
input ioctl_wr,
input [24:0] ioctl_addr,
input [7:0] ioctl_dout,
output ioctl_wait,
input clk,
input ce_1m,
input reset
);
/////////////////////////////////////////////////////////////
// Orao ROM combining the system ROM and BASIC.
// System rom mapped from E000-FFFF
// Basic is mapped from C000-DFFF
/////////////////////////////////////////////////////////////
wire [7:0] rom_data;
orao_rom rom
(
.q_a(rom_data),
.address_a(addr[13:0]),
.clock(clk)
);
//////////////////////////////////////////////////////////////
// Orao RAM and video RAM. Video RAM is dual ported.
//////////////////////////////////////////////////////////////
wire [7:0] ram_data;
wire [7:0] vram_data;
wire [7:0] video_data;
wire [12:0] video_addr;
wire ram_we = we && (addr[15:13] < 3'b011);
wire vram_we = we && (addr[15:13] == 3'b011);
orao_ram ram
(
.clock(clk),
.q_a(ram_data),
.data_a(data_in),
.address_a(addr[14:0]),
.wren_a(ram_we)
);
orao_vram vidram
(
.clock(clk),
.address_a(addr[12:0]),
.data_a(data_in),
.wren_a(vram_we),
.q_a(vram_data),
.address_b(video_addr),
.data_b(0),
.wren_b(0),
.q_b(video_data)
);
//////////////////////////////////////
// Video hardware.
//////////////////////////////////////
wire video_on; // signal indicating VGA is scanning visible
// rows. Used to generate tick inte rrupts.
wire video_blank; // blank screen during scrolling
orao_video vid(.*);
////////////////////////////////////////////////////////
// I/O hardware
////////////////////////////////////////////////////////
wire [7:0] io_read_data;
wire io_we = we && (addr[15:13] == 3'b100);
orao_io io
(
.*,
.ce(ce_1m),
.data_out(io_read_data),
.data_in(data_in),
.we(io_we),
.ps2_key(ps2_key),
.video_sync(video_on)
);
/////////////////////////////////////
// Read data mux (to CPU)
/////////////////////////////////////
always @(*)
case(addr[15:13])
3'b110,
3'b111: // E000-FFFF
data_out = rom_data;
3'b100: // 8000-9FFF
data_out = io_read_data;
3'b011: // 6000-7FFF
data_out = vram_data;
default:
data_out = ram_data;
endcase
endmodule
